Definitions from Wiktionary (block booking)
▸ noun: The reservation of a large number of hotel rooms, tickets, etc. at one time.
▸ noun: (film industry, historical) The sale of multiple films to a theater as a unit, sight unseen, allowing the studio to package inferior films with more popular ones.
